Warez Groups Warez groups are organized bands of software pirates. Warez groups illegally obtain, crack, and make copies of copyrighted software, movies, and music. These files are known as ‘‘releases’’ in the warez community. The groups are not typically motivated by financial profit. Instead, warez groups compete with one another to [...]

Identity Theft Identity theft, also referred to as identity fraud, is a criminal act where one individual misrepresents himself by pretending to be someone else. This is typically done by illegally using the victim’s personal information to open new financial accounts, use existing financial accounts, or do some combination of the two. [...]

Music and Movie Piracy Music piracy has become an important issue since the turn of the century. As the Internet has grown, sales of counterfeit CDs through online auctions, Web sites, newsgroups, spam, and other channels have increased significantly.
